N
Login to add your ratings.
0 Reviews
Delhi, India
Mumbai
hefei
UAE
Mumbai, Maharashtra, India
China
3rd Kumbharwada, Girgaon, Mumbai, Maharashtra 400004
LOCATION
Chembarambakkam, Tamil Nadu, India
EMPLOYEE
51-500 Employees
EMAIL
*******@nagmanflow.com
© Copyrights 2025, Enggpro Business Solutions Private Limited all rights reserved.
About Us | Contact Us | Terms of Use | Privacy Policy | FAQs